Fluid Milk Production Operator at Toft Dairy

Toft Dairy Sandusky, OH

Job Description

Job Title: Fluid Milk Production OperatorJob Summary:The Fluid Milk Production Operator is responsible for operating and maintaining press equipment used in milk and dairy product processing. This role ensures the efficient and sanitary production of milk products by adhering to all safety quality and operational standards. The operator monitors equipment performance manages production flows and supports overall dairy processing operations. Key Responsibilities:Operate Fluid milk machinery and related equipment according to standard operating procedures (SOPs).Set up and adjust machinery to ensure proper function during production runs.Monitor equipment and product quality during operation; make adjustments as needed.Perform routine checks for product consistency temperature and flow rates.Maintain cleanliness and sanitation of equipment and work area in compliance with food safety standards (e.g. FSMA GMP).Set up/tear down and daily sanitation of tanks.Follow all legal standards set by the Pasteurized Milk Ordinance (PMO) for the production and processing of Grade A milk. Complete production records batch logs and other required documentation accurately and in a timely manner.Report equipment malfunctions safety hazards or quality issues to the supervisor immediately.Assist with preventative maintenance and minor repairs on press equipment.Follow all company safety protocols and wear appropriate PPE.Support other production areas as needed to maintain workflow and productivity.Qualifications:High school diploma or GED required.Prior experience in a dairy food or beverage manufacturing environment preferred.Mechanical aptitude and ability to troubleshoot basic equipment issues.Understanding of food safety and sanitation practices (FSMA GMP).Ability to work independently and as part of a team.Physically able to lift 50 lbs stand for extended periods and work in cold/wet environments.Preferred Skills:Experience with pasteurization equipment.Basic computer skills for data entry and reporting.Forklift experience desired.Work Schedule & Conditions:Hours: Midnight to approximately NoonWork Days: Monday Tuesday Thursday and Friday (No Wednesday Weekends Off)Must be available for overtime as requiredStanding for long periods; working in wet cold or hot conditions may be requiredExposure to cold temperatures noise and wet conditions typical of dairy production facilities.Fast-paced environment with strict hygiene and quality controlsBenefits:Competitive payMedical insurance (After 60 days)Dental and vision insurance offered (After 90 days)Vacation/Sick time issued at the beginning of each calendar year401k Retirement offered day one/company match after 6 months Summary:The legacy of Toft Dairy is a story of commitment to quality and forward-thinking principles.
